Winter Break December 2005
The Essex area of the club, to beat the winter blues and break up the period of Panther inactivity, take themselves off on a "jolly" in November or December each year. This year we treated ourselves to a weekend of Motown and Soul at Gunton Hall just north of Lowestoft. We'd been here before so we knew what to expect and it didn't take us long to realise we were all "up for it". There wasn't a dull moment. From 3pm Friday to noon on Sunday it was all go. Day time entertainment included crown green bowling, swimming, snooker, quizses, archery and for the ladies pampering in the various beauty salons. In the evening there was an early disco, then the dancing to the guest band followed by the late disco. The highlight was the Jimmy James and he Vagabonds. We reckoned Jimmy James must be about 65, but both he and his band were excellent. His rich strong voice effortlessly pumped out Motown song after song. Once he came on, the floor was packed and it was to remain that way until he finished. AND --------IT SNOWED!
